<p>jmmom, I don't think it's at all out of the question for him to do another year at Tulane, and still transfer to an engineering-type program at another school if he wants. Most engineering programs require a lot of math and physics, and a few humanities/writing etc. classes too; it just means that he'll rearrange the curriculum, as it were.</p>

<p>Check out the JHU catalog online, for example. It lists all the courses necessary for a mech eng degree, or other eng degree. Unless he wants a very specialized eng degree, like aerospace or biomed, he can probably make 2 years at Tulane fit most requirements, even engineering mechanics (heavy math).</p>
